We were looking to get away for a couple of days and the name Perpignan came up. In 1967 my husband was in a band who were booked to play a residency at the beached ocean liner "Le Lydia", located opposite the apartment building in Le Barcarès. However, it turned out that the boat wasn't ready yet, so they spent 5 weeks hanging around and they slept on the boat, which after its Sixties heyday was turned into a tourist attraction. We decided to go on a bit of a sentimental journey and found this lovely apartment in Le Barcarès. We booked it for three nights but we would have liked to stay longer because we enjoyed it very much! The apartment is renovated with love and excellent taste and sits in a great location, just a couple of minutes' walk from the beach. Parking was secure and easy, and access to the apartment is via a code or an app you can download on your phone. The living room is bright and welcoming, with a well-equipped kitchen area (although a kettle would have been nice - we brought our own - and a couple of serving spoons would have been handy). There's a spacious terrace with a table that can easily seat at least six people. The James Bond-style multi socket column that rises from the kitchen island is very handy if you want to do a bit of work on your laptop after breakfast. The living area features a comfy sofa and a large Smart TV, great for evening entertainment! The bed was comfortable and the bathrooms clean (great to have a bath and a shower!). The views on the Mediterranean from the top floor terrace are wonderful. We were lucky that the sun was out on both days, so we spent most of the time on the sandy beach and in the sea. There's a fresh bakery almost next-door and we had dinner at "La Jungle", right on the beach, which serves delicious food and mocktails!     Leucate has different areas, the village location where we stayed had the history, lovely bakery and a variety of restaurants. A visit to Port Leucate gave you a beach area, promenade walk and then restaurants and shops to visit. The beach was sandt, you would need to bring your own towels, sun shades etc as only one bar are with seating you coud pay for. Lots of familes on the beach when we visited and in the sea, but as it was so bigit didn't feel packed. The lighthouse is also worth a visit, but parking can be tricky. Great view looking back down the length of Leucate.
